We are seeking a passionate and experienced Pre-Sales Engineer to join our team. In this role, you will identify customer needs and their systems ecosystem to determine the optimal solutions. You will showcase how Go1 features, functionality, and our partner ecosystem can be combined to create the perfect solution for our clients. With a strong technical understanding of integration touch points and systems, you will design solutions within a diverse ecosystem of partners, products, and platforms. Your extensive experience working with Enterprise customers will enable you to anticipate and navigate the procurement, information security, solution sign-off, and due diligence stages, ensuring alignment with the prospect and account executive at every step

Here’s a Taste of What You’ll Be Doing:

  • Participate in pre-sale's discovery and solution design – supporting our sales teams in identifying the solution and effort. You will be the ‘technical and product pitcher’
  • Optimize our demonstrations for the customer – make sure we echo their needs in what we present. Help create a mutual understanding of the solution
  • Participate in product and solution design workshops with prospects – what features are required and what might need to be leveraged from our partner ecosystem
  • Where required, run short ‘proof of concept’ projects – designed to provide ultimate proof of Go1’s capability (being sure to make visible the cost/effort and ROI)
  • Work together with our implementation teams – continuously ensuring we ‘pitching the possible’ and teams are briefed about incoming work
  • Recommend and where needed, implement, process improvement as we adapt and scale the pre-sale's function – calling on your experience of what works
  • Participate in cross-functional retrospectives to review win/lose rate and identify areas of improvements across all teams
  • Collaborate with Go1 product and engineering teams – bring the voice of the customer into roadmap and feature planning where possible (use your data)
  • Articulate the optimal solution for the customers and own the architecture solution
  • 3-5 years technical experience in either a solution design or technical pre-sale's role
  • Considerable experience operating within an ecosystem of products and partner platforms where shared solutions are developed
  • Considerable experience working with SaaS platform integrations
  • Considerable experience in technical writing and participating in the bid, RFP or RFI process (particularly regarding infosec and technical due diligence)
  • Experience with scrum and basic agile practices and rituals
  • Experience managing complex technical projects between external customers, internal stakeholders and 3rd parties
  • Preference experience working as a software developer or product manager/designer
  • Preference for candidates in Eastern or Central timezones

A successful applicant should have advanced or better skills in most of the following:

  • Formal project management or solution/business systems architecture accreditation
  • Experience in scaling a solution design or pre-sales function
  • A degree in a relevant field or equivalent professional experience

At Go1, your base pay is one part of your total compensation package. This role pays between $130,000 and $140,000 and your actual base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, and experience. This role is also eligible for the employee bonus plan and employee stock options.
